資料介紹
描述
對(duì)許多人來(lái)說(shuō),控制監(jiān)控機(jī)器人是一件令人愉快的事情。另一方面,我們有 PlayStation 4 控制臺(tái)控制器,到目前為止,它給我們留下了美好的回憶。PlayStation 控制器和控制機(jī)器人的組合非常有吸引力。在本教程中,我們將學(xué)習(xí)如何構(gòu)建基于 Raspberry Pi 的機(jī)器人并使用 PS4 控制器控制該機(jī)器人。在開始構(gòu)建機(jī)器人之前,您可以觀看完整的教程視頻。
首先我們看一下硬件原理圖。
?

在上圖中,您可以看到所有部件和連接。機(jī)器人電路非常簡(jiǎn)單,沒(méi)有特別的細(xì)節(jié)。我們只需要考慮我們需要一個(gè)電流約為 2 安培的 5 伏電源來(lái)啟動(dòng)電機(jī)。我們還可以使用移動(dòng)電源打開樹莓派。我們使用攝像頭模塊進(jìn)行視頻錄制。該相機(jī)模塊只需使用標(biāo)準(zhǔn)電纜連接到 Raspberry Pi。市場(chǎng)上有很多攝像頭模組,您可以根據(jù)自己的預(yù)算購(gòu)買。
完成機(jī)器人電路后,就該進(jìn)行編程了。我們使用 Python 進(jìn)行編程。
我們使用藍(lán)牙連接將控制器連接到機(jī)器人。要將控制器連接到機(jī)器人,我們需要在樹莓派中打開藍(lán)牙連接。在樹莓派上打開藍(lán)牙后,按住PS4控制器上的Share和PS按鈕,直到控制器燈閃爍,此時(shí)控制器進(jìn)入配對(duì)模式,我們可以在藍(lán)牙設(shè)備列表中看到控制器的名稱。
將控制器連接到樹莓派后,就可以通過(guò) Python 接收控制器的命令了。為此,我們使用 pyPS4Controller 庫(kù)。我們進(jìn)入終端并輸入以下命令:
pip install pyps4controller
或者
pip3 install pyps4controller
您可以在此鏈接中查看有關(guān) pyPS4Controller 庫(kù)的所有詳細(xì)信息。
將控制器連接到樹莓派并接收到命令后,工作就差不多完成了,我們只需要根據(jù)從控制器接收到的命令執(zhí)行必要的條件,控制機(jī)器人不同方向。這非常簡(jiǎn)單,您將通過(guò)閱讀我放在文章末尾的源代碼來(lái)了解這一點(diǎn)。
最后,是時(shí)候展示機(jī)器人攝像頭視頻了。為此,我們使用默認(rèn)的 Raspberry Pi 相機(jī)模塊庫(kù)。使用該庫(kù)的指令非常簡(jiǎn)單,您將通過(guò)閱讀源代碼來(lái)學(xué)習(xí)如何使用該庫(kù)的指令。
現(xiàn)在您可以享受與機(jī)器人玩耍的樂(lè)趣了。
- DIY機(jī)器人控制器
- 樹莓派機(jī)器人船構(gòu)建
- 樹莓派軟電源控制器開源分享
- 基于樹莓派的移動(dòng)機(jī)器人實(shí)現(xiàn)
- 相撲機(jī)器人控制器
- 基于DSP控制器的油氣安全智能巡檢機(jī)器人 41次下載
- 基于DSP的高壓訓(xùn)線機(jī)器人數(shù)字化控制器 11次下載
- 遠(yuǎn)程視頻監(jiān)控和遠(yuǎn)程機(jī)器人控制方案應(yīng)該如何設(shè)計(jì) 1次下載
- 樹莓派3和樹莓派4的原理圖免費(fèi)下載 92次下載
- 樹莓派3和樹莓派4的原理圖免費(fèi)下載 224次下載
- 機(jī)器人控制器電路圖 17次下載
- 自平衡人形機(jī)器人動(dòng)作控制器的設(shè)計(jì)
- 基于SOPC的機(jī)器人伺服控制器的研究 55次下載
- 基于PMAC的機(jī)器人控制器調(diào)試系統(tǒng)的研制
- 仿人機(jī)器人控制系統(tǒng)研究及其關(guān)節(jié)控制器設(shè)計(jì)
- 如何使用PLC控制機(jī)器人 1882次閱讀
- 基于樹莓派的交互機(jī)器人設(shè)計(jì) 1259次閱讀
- ROS移動(dòng)機(jī)器人的通信接口電路設(shè)計(jì) 1552次閱讀
- KUKA機(jī)器人C4外部自動(dòng)控制最終版介紹 2504次閱讀
- KUKA機(jī)器人C4外部自動(dòng)控制最終版-v1介紹 1378次閱讀
- 如何使用樹莓派制作一個(gè)巡線機(jī)器人 6014次閱讀
- 基于LPC2114處理器實(shí)現(xiàn)人形機(jī)器人控制系統(tǒng)的設(shè)計(jì) 3718次閱讀
- 基于PIC單片機(jī)和PSC控制器實(shí)現(xiàn)機(jī)器人控制系統(tǒng)的設(shè)計(jì) 4085次閱讀
- 機(jī)器人控制系統(tǒng)分類_機(jī)器人控制系統(tǒng)有哪些 2.6w次閱讀
- 焊接機(jī)器人控制器的作用 6278次閱讀
- 機(jī)器人控制器有哪些類型_機(jī)器人控制器發(fā)展 1.2w次閱讀
- 移動(dòng)機(jī)器人控制系統(tǒng)設(shè)計(jì)與仿真 3640次閱讀
- 機(jī)器人控制系統(tǒng)的基本單元與機(jī)器人控制系統(tǒng)的特點(diǎn)分析 1.1w次閱讀
- 機(jī)器人的運(yùn)動(dòng)控制的介紹和如何將機(jī)器人的運(yùn)動(dòng)控制分成4種任務(wù) 1w次閱讀
- 一種實(shí)用的機(jī)器人控制器力/位混合控制技術(shù) 6176次閱讀
下載排行
本周
- 1NS1081/NS1081S/NS1081Q USB 3.0閃存數(shù)據(jù)手冊(cè)
- 0.40 MB | 4次下載 | 2 積分
- 2光伏并網(wǎng)逆變器原理
- 7.31 MB | 3次下載 | 2 積分
- 3T20電烙鐵原理圖資料
- 0.27 MB | 2次下載 | 免費(fèi)
- 4PL83081 雙路恒流同步降壓轉(zhuǎn)換器技術(shù)手冊(cè)
- 3.34 MB | 1次下載 | 免費(fèi)
- 5PL88052 4.8V至60V輸入,5A,同步降壓轉(zhuǎn)換器技術(shù)手冊(cè)
- 3.36 MB | 1次下載 | 免費(fèi)
- 6LX8201微孔霧化驅(qū)動(dòng)芯片電路圖資料
- 0.15 MB | 1次下載 | 免費(fèi)
- 7PC6200_7V直流電機(jī)驅(qū)動(dòng)器技術(shù)手冊(cè)
- 0.47 MB | 次下載 | 免費(fèi)
- 8恒溫晶體振蕩器(OCXO)FOC-2D:20.6×20.6mm在通信基站和測(cè)試設(shè)備中的應(yīng)用參數(shù)規(guī)格
- 485.75 KB | 次下載 | 免費(fèi)
本月
- 1如何看懂電子電路圖
- 12.88 MB | 329次下載 | 免費(fèi)
- 2RK3588數(shù)據(jù)手冊(cè)
- 2.24 MB | 14次下載 | 免費(fèi)
- 3PC5502負(fù)載均流控制電路數(shù)據(jù)手冊(cè)
- 1.63 MB | 12次下載 | 免費(fèi)
- 4STM32F10x參考手冊(cè)資料
- 13.64 MB | 12次下載 | 1 積分
- 5OAH0428 V1.0英文規(guī)格書
- 5.86 MB | 8次下載 | 免費(fèi)
- 6NS1081/NS1081S/NS1081Q USB 3.0閃存數(shù)據(jù)手冊(cè)
- 0.40 MB | 4次下載 | 2 積分
- 7PID控制算法學(xué)習(xí)筆記資料
- 3.43 MB | 3次下載 | 2 積分
- 8光伏并網(wǎng)逆變器原理
- 7.31 MB | 3次下載 | 2 積分
總榜
- 1matlab軟件下載入口
- 未知 | 935132次下載 | 10 積分
- 2開源硬件-PMP21529.1-4 開關(guān)降壓/升壓雙向直流/直流轉(zhuǎn)換器 PCB layout 設(shè)計(jì)
- 1.48MB | 420064次下載 | 10 積分
- 3Altium DXP2002下載入口
- 未知 | 233089次下載 | 10 積分
- 4電路仿真軟件multisim 10.0免費(fèi)下載
- 340992 | 191415次下載 | 10 積分
- 5十天學(xué)會(huì)AVR單片機(jī)與C語(yǔ)言視頻教程 下載
- 158M | 183349次下載 | 10 積分
- 6labview8.5下載
- 未知 | 81599次下載 | 10 積分
- 7Keil工具M(jìn)DK-Arm免費(fèi)下載
- 0.02 MB | 73818次下載 | 10 積分
- 8LabVIEW 8.6下載
- 未知 | 65990次下載 | 10 積分
評(píng)論